History
In 1969 the Dubini family bought the Palazzone, a hostel built around 1300 for pilgrims heading to Rome for the Jubilee.
Angelo Dubini planted 25 hectares, and his sons Giovanni and Lodovico made the first small vintage in 1982.
By 1988 they built a winery and began marketing Palazzone, now one of Umbria's most significant labels.
Wines
Illustrative selectionTerre Vineate
Orvieto Classico Superiore, the estate's core white.
Campo del Guardiano
Age-worthy single-vineyard Orvieto Classico.
Grechetto
Varietal Umbrian Grechetto.
